如果定义了int (*pointer)[5],则如下描述正确的是____。
A: 定义了指向5个元素的指针
B: 定义了指针数组
C: 定义了5个整型变量
D: 定义5个元素整型数组
A: 定义了指向5个元素的指针
B: 定义了指针数组
C: 定义了5个整型变量
D: 定义5个元素整型数组
举一反三
- 说明语句:int (*p)[5]; 的含义是 。 A: 定义了5个指向整型变量的指针变量。 B: 定义了5个指向函数的指针变量。 C: 定义了一个指向具有5个整型元素的一维数组的指针变量。 D: 定义了一个包含5个元素的指针数组。
- 定义一个指向具有5个元素的一维整型数组的指针变量的正确定义为 A: int *p[5]; B: int *p; C: int (*p)[5]; D: int *p[][5];
- int (*p)[4]含义是? A: 定义了一个指针数组p[4] B: 定义了四个指针变量 C: 定义了一个指向数组的指针变量p D: 定义了一个整型指针变量p
- 若有定义“int *p[5];”,则以下叙述中正确的是 A: 定义了一个指针数组p,该数组含有5个元素,每个元素都是基类型为int的指针变量 B: 定义了一个基类型为int的指针变量p,该变量有5个指针 C: 定义了一个名为*p的整型数组,该数组含有5个int类型元素 D: 定义了一个可指向一维数组的指针变量p,所指一维数组应具有5个int类型元素
- 若有定义“int*p[5];”,则以下叙述中正确的是() A: 定义了一个基类型为int的指针变量p,该变量有5个指针 B: 定义了一个指针数组p,该数组含有5个元素,每个元素都是基类型为int的指针变量 C: 定义了一个名为*p的整型数组,该数组含有5个int类型元素 D: 定义了一个可指向一维数组的指针变量p,所指一维数组应具有5个int类型元素